来源:小编 更新:2024-10-05 08:50:19
用手机看
1. 增强沉浸感
通过手势控制游戏,玩家可以更加直观地参与到游戏中,仿佛自己真的置身于游戏世界,从而增强游戏的沉浸感。
2. 提高游戏体验
手势控制游戏可以减少玩家对传统操作方式的依赖,让玩家更加专注于游戏内容,提高游戏体验。
3. 适应不同人群
手势控制游戏适合不同年龄、不同技能水平的玩家,让更多人能够享受到游戏的乐趣。
1. 选择合适的硬件设备
要实现手势控制游戏,首先需要选择一款支持手势识别的硬件设备,如智能手机、平板电脑、VR设备等。
2. 选择合适的手势识别软件
目前市面上有很多手势识别软件,如OpenCV、mediapipe等,可以根据自己的需求选择合适的软件。
3. 开发游戏逻辑
在开发游戏逻辑时,需要将手势识别与游戏操作相结合,实现玩家通过手势控制游戏角色的移动、攻击等动作。
1. 引入库
在Python中,可以使用pygame库实现游戏界面,使用mediapipe库实现手势识别。
2. 实现游戏逻辑
初始化pygame和mediapipe,并设置游戏的基本参数,如屏幕大小、蛇的大小等。
接着,定义蛇和食物类,实现游戏中的蛇和食物的显示与移动。
实现手势识别功能,让玩家可以通过手势控制蛇的移动方向。
手势控制游戏作为一种新兴的人机交互方式,具有很多优势。通过本文的介绍,相信您已经对如何实现手势控制游戏有了初步的了解。在未来的游戏开发中,手势控制游戏将会越来越普及,为玩家带来更多乐趣。